If persuasive messages are too forward, forceful, or coercive, the individual does not exhibit the desired attitude and sometimes even exhibits the opposite attitude. People feel their freedom or autonomy is under threat or being encroached upon. D. a. r. e program is an example of attitude inoculation. Advertisements for colognes are usually affectively based, while advertisements for more objective products such as kitchen appliances are cognitively based. Attitude inoculation against peer pressure to smoke - inoculated group is more likely to not smoke when pressured to do so, antibodies /countermeasures have been developed over exposure. Subliminal priming works - people have to focus on the stimulus without distractions, people are asked to respond immediately afterwards. Subliminal advertising does not work because it does not follow these key points. An alternative possibility - behavior changes attitude (changes in how you act can change how you think or feel about something)
